Titanic explorer fears for wreck's future

Titanic explorer fears for wreck's future

Undersea tourists and souvenir hunters are hastening the decay of the Titanic, says U.S. explorer Bob Ballard, who discovered the world's most famous shipwreck nearly 20 years ago.

In a visit last June to the site of the Titanic -- his first since 1985 -- Ballard was shocked at how fast the wreckage had deteriorated. Now he wants Congress to pass legislation giving greater protection to the sunken vessel.
